Section:15Heading:Referring back to committeeVersion Date:30/06/1997

(1) Where, after a case has been referred to the Council for inquiry, further information is subsequently produced in writing which suggests that an inquiry should not be held, the Chairman may refer back the case to the Committee, the Health Committee or the Education and Accreditation Committee, as the case may be, for further consideration.
(2) As soon as may be after the case is referred back to the Committee, the Health Committee or the Education and Accreditation Committee, as the case may be, the chairman of the committee shall direct the Secretary to, and the Secretary when so directed shall, advise the complainant and the defendant accordingly.

(Enacted 1996)
